@zaydmosh
@zaydmosh - 14.01.2024 10:43

I started with classical guitar with a great teacher (Miroslav Kefurt from Czechoslovakia) who gave me great training with nails. However, I eventually progressed to renaissance lute, which is without nails. I struggled between the two because I didn't want to lose the guitar repertoire that I had worked so hard on achieving.
Life interrupted and passed a number of decades not being able to play at all. During Covid lockdowns I came back to lute - this time without nails - and it's going well. However, I'd still like to be able to play some of my original guitar repertoire (like Recuerdos de la Alhambra, Bach BVW 999 (unless I can afford a Baroque lute in the meantime 😁)). So maybe this course will be what I need!
One question - I assume playing nail-less involves using low tension strings (like lute), but what are recommendations for an appropriate guitar (not too expensive) for nail-less playing?

@jasongultjaeff9397
@jasongultjaeff9397 - 14.01.2024 03:43

I hate having nails to play classical guitar. It's a pain...and I get plenty of weird looks here and there from people that don't know why. I must admit though, I think classical guitar sounds better played with nails. Even on those small clips in this video, some of the notes were a little harder to hear and a bit less defined. Almost "muddy" sounding. It's like the initial attack with the nail defines the note more cleanly. I'll persist for the sound and I'm lucky I can get away with them for my job and the rest of my sports / hobbies.
